Thatching is the process of removing the layer of dead lawn, roots, and organic debris that builds up in between the soil and living lawn, which can restrain water, air, and nutrient absorption. Extreme thatch can result in shallow root systems, increased insect problems, and uneven growth. Strategies for thatching include manual raking or the use of specialized dethatching devices that lifts and gets rid of the layer without destructive healthy turf The procedure is often followed by aeration, overseeding, or fertilization to promote healthy healing and growth. Regular thatching guarantees much better soil-to-grass contact, improves nutrient uptake, and maintains a lush, resilient yard. Integrating thatching into yard care routines enhances both the look and long-term health of turf.
